Your contact form is often the final hurdle between a potential lead and a meaningful connection with your business. Yet many high-growth teams overlook this critical touchpoint, leaving conversions on the table with forms that feel like interrogations rather than invitations. When visitors abandon your contact form, they're not just leaving a page—they're walking away from a potential relationship with your brand.
Think about it: someone has navigated through your website, read your content, maybe even compared you to competitors. They're ready to reach out. Then they encounter a form asking for their life story, presented in a confusing layout, with vague instructions. That momentum evaporates instantly.
This guide walks you through a practical, step-by-step process to optimize contact form design for maximum conversions. You'll learn how to audit your current form's performance, eliminate friction points that cause abandonment, craft questions that qualify leads without overwhelming visitors, and implement design principles that guide users toward completion.
Whether you're starting from scratch or refining an existing form, these actionable steps will help you create contact forms that feel effortless to complete while delivering the qualified leads your sales team needs. Let's transform your contact form from a conversion barrier into a competitive advantage.
Step 1: Audit Your Current Form Performance and Identify Drop-Off Points
Before you change anything, you need to understand what's actually happening with your current form. Too many teams jump straight to redesign without documenting baseline performance, making it impossible to measure improvement later.
Start by pulling analytics data for the past 30-90 days. You're looking for three critical metrics: overall form completion rate, average time users spend on the form page, and field-by-field abandonment data. Your analytics platform should show you where users start filling out the form but don't complete it.
Pay special attention to abandonment patterns. Does everyone breeze through the first two fields but bail at field three? That's your friction point. Do users spend an unusually long time on a particular field before leaving? That field is either confusing or asking for information they're reluctant to share.
If your analytics don't track field-level behavior, tools like Hotjar or Microsoft Clarity can show you session recordings of actual users interacting with your form. Watch five to ten recordings where users abandoned the form. The patterns become obvious quickly—you'll see hesitation, confusion, or outright frustration at specific points.
Document everything in a simple spreadsheet. Note your current completion rate, the specific fields causing problems, and any patterns in user behavior. This becomes your optimization roadmap. If 60% of users abandon at the phone number field, you know exactly where to focus your efforts. Understanding why generic contact forms aren't converting often starts with this kind of detailed analysis.
Here's your success indicator for this step: you should have concrete numbers showing your current conversion rate and a prioritized list of the biggest friction points. If you can't point to specific data about where and why users abandon your form, you're not ready to move forward. No guessing allowed—let the data tell you where to start.
Step 2: Reduce Form Fields to Essential Information Only
Now comes the hard part: cutting fields. Every field you ask for creates another decision point, another moment where a visitor can question whether this conversation is worth their time. The brutal truth? Most contact forms ask for way too much information upfront.
List every field in your current form. Then ask yourself this question for each one: "Do I absolutely need this information to have a meaningful first conversation with this lead?" Not "would it be nice to have" or "our sales team likes having this." You need it to start the conversation, or you don't.
For most businesses, a contact form only needs three to five fields: name, email, company (if B2B), and a message or reason for contact. That's it. Everything else—phone number, job title, company size, budget, timeline—can be gathered later through conversation or progressive profiling. Learning how to optimize form fields for conversions means understanding this essential principle.
Let's address the immediate objection: "But our sales team needs to qualify leads before reaching out!" Fair concern. Here's the thing—asking for extensive qualification information upfront optimizes for sales convenience at the expense of conversion rate. You're choosing fewer, more qualified leads over more leads that require brief qualification.
The math often favors more leads. If your current form with 12 fields converts at 8% but captures perfectly qualified leads, and a streamlined 4-field form converts at 18% with leads requiring 2 minutes of qualification, you've more than doubled your pipeline. Your sales team can handle that brief qualification call.
Start by cutting any field that's optional. If it's optional, it shouldn't be there—you're creating visual clutter and cognitive load for information you've admitted you don't actually need. Next, examine required fields critically. Can that dropdown menu with 20 industry options become a simple text field? Can you eliminate the "How did you hear about us?" field that nobody ever uses for meaningful analysis?
Be ruthless. Every field you remove makes your form feel faster and easier to complete. Your success indicator here is simple: your form asks only for information required to have that first conversation. If you're still asking for information that would be "nice to know" rather than "need to know," keep cutting.
Step 3: Implement Smart Field Logic and Progressive Disclosure
Here's where optimization gets interesting. You've stripped your form down to essentials, but what if you need different information from different types of leads? Conditional logic solves this elegantly by showing additional fields only when they're relevant based on previous answers.
Think of it like a conversation that adapts to what someone tells you. If a visitor selects "I'm interested in enterprise solutions" from a dropdown, you might show an additional field asking about team size. If they select "I have a question about pricing," that field stays hidden because it's irrelevant. The form feels personalized without overwhelming everyone with every possible question.
Start by mapping out your different lead types and what unique information you need from each. Maybe enterprise prospects need to specify their current solution, while individual users don't. Maybe support requests need a product dropdown, while sales inquiries don't. Write out these logic trees before you build anything. An intelligent contact form builder can make implementing these logic trees much simpler.
Most modern form builders support conditional logic natively. Set up rules that show or hide fields based on previous selections. Keep the logic simple—if you need a flowchart with more than two levels of branching, you're overcomplicating things. The goal is to make the form feel adaptive, not to create a choose-your-own-adventure novel.
Test every possible path through your form yourself. Select each option in your initial dropdown and verify that the right fields appear. Make sure nothing breaks—conditional logic gone wrong creates a worse experience than no logic at all. Users should never see fields appear and disappear chaotically as they type.
The key benefit of progressive disclosure is psychological: your form always looks simple. A visitor sees three fields initially, which feels manageable. As they engage and provide information, showing one or two additional relevant fields doesn't feel burdensome—they're already invested in completing the form.
Your success indicator: test the form yourself by going through each possible path. It should feel conversational and natural, revealing complexity only when necessary. If you find yourself thinking "wow, this is complicated" as you test it, your users will feel the same way. Simplify the logic or reconsider whether you truly need those conditional fields.
Step 4: Optimize Visual Design and Field Layout for Clarity
You've got the right fields asking the right questions. Now let's make sure users can actually complete your form without thinking. Visual design creates the path of least resistance—or it creates friction that makes even simple forms feel complicated.
Start with layout: use a single-column format. Always. Multi-column forms look compact but force users to scan back and forth, creating uncertainty about what to fill out next. Single column creates a clear top-to-bottom flow that matches how people naturally read and process information. Following web form design best practices consistently will guide your visual decisions.
Place labels above fields, not to the left. Left-aligned labels create awkward spacing and force users to scan horizontally to connect label to field. Labels above fields create a clear vertical rhythm: read the label, fill the field, move down, repeat. It's faster and requires less cognitive effort.
Give your fields room to breathe. Cramped spacing makes forms feel overwhelming and increases mistakes—users accidentally tap the wrong field on mobile or miss required fields entirely. Aim for at least 15-20 pixels of vertical spacing between fields. White space isn't wasted space; it's clarity.
Make your field inputs large enough to be obviously interactive. Small, subtle form fields create uncertainty about where to click or tap. Your input fields should be at least 44 pixels tall—the minimum comfortable touch target size for mobile devices. If it works well on mobile, it'll work great on desktop.
Create visual hierarchy with your submit button. It should be the most prominent element on the form—larger than other elements, using your primary brand color, with adequate padding around it. Users should never have to search for how to submit the form. The button should practically call out "I'm done, click here!"
Consider adding subtle visual progress indicators if your form has multiple sections or steps. A simple "Step 2 of 3" or a progress bar helps users understand how much effort remains. This is particularly important for longer forms where users might abandon if they don't know how close they are to completion.
Use appropriate input types for each field. Email fields should trigger the email keyboard on mobile. Phone fields should bring up the numeric keypad. Date fields should show a date picker, not force users to type in a specific format. These small details eliminate friction and reduce errors.
Your success indicator: hand your device to someone unfamiliar with your form and watch them complete it without any instructions from you. They shouldn't hesitate, squint, or ask questions about what's expected. If they complete it smoothly without confusion, your visual design is working. Any hesitation or confusion means you have work to do.
Step 5: Write Microcopy That Reduces Friction and Builds Trust
Every word on your form matters. Microcopy—those small bits of text in labels, placeholders, error messages, and buttons—either guides users forward or creates moments of hesitation. Most forms fail here by using generic, unhelpful text that leaves users guessing.
Start with your field labels. Be specific and conversational. Instead of "Name," try "Your name" or "What should we call you?" Instead of "Email," use "Your email address" or "Where can we reach you?" These small changes make forms feel more human and less like database fields.
Use placeholder text strategically, but never as a replacement for labels. Placeholders should provide examples or additional context, not primary instructions. For an email field, a placeholder might show "name@company.com" to clarify format. For a message field, try "Tell us what you're looking for..." to prompt specific information. These details are essential when designing user-friendly contact forms.
Write error messages that actually help users fix problems. "Error: Invalid input" tells users nothing. "Please enter a valid email address like name@company.com" tells them exactly what went wrong and how to fix it. Better yet, use inline validation that catches errors as users type, preventing frustration before submission.
Add privacy reassurance near sensitive fields or at the bottom of your form. A simple "We'll never share your information" or "Your privacy is important to us—see our privacy policy" can eliminate the hesitation that stops users from submitting. Trust is earned through small signals like this.
Your submit button deserves special attention. "Submit" is boring and vague. What happens when they submit? Try action-oriented copy that tells users what comes next: "Get Started," "Send My Message," "Request a Demo," or "Talk to Our Team." Make it specific to what they're actually doing.
Consider adding a brief expectation-setting message near the submit button: "We'll respond within 24 hours" or "Expect a reply from our team today." This reduces anxiety about what happens after submission and can increase completion rates by eliminating the "will anyone actually see this?" concern.
Read through every piece of text on your form out loud. Does it sound like something a real person would say in a conversation? Or does it sound like corporate jargon or database field names? If you wouldn't say it to someone face-to-face, rewrite it.
Your success indicator: every piece of text on your form serves a clear purpose. There are no generic "Submit" buttons, no vague error messages, and no moments where a user might wonder "what do they mean by this?" If you can't explain why a specific piece of microcopy exists, it probably shouldn't be there.
Step 6: Test Mobile Experience and Page Load Performance
Mobile visitors often have the highest intent but the lowest patience. They're reaching out in the moment, between meetings or during their commute. A clunky mobile form experience doesn't just reduce conversions—it can damage your brand perception entirely.
Grab your phone and complete your form. Not just a quick glance—actually fill out every field as if you were a real prospect. Are the fields large enough to tap accurately? Does the right keyboard appear for each field type? Can you easily move between fields? Any friction you feel, your users feel tenfold.
Check your touch targets. Every interactive element—fields, buttons, checkboxes—should be at least 44x44 pixels. Smaller targets create frustration as users miss their intended target and have to try again. This is especially critical for radio buttons and checkboxes, which are often too small by default. Understanding how to optimize forms for mobile is essential for capturing these high-intent visitors.
Test your form on multiple devices and browsers. That beautiful form that works perfectly on your iPhone might be broken on Android. The layout that looks great in Chrome might be misaligned in Safari. You don't need to test every possible combination, but hit the major platforms your analytics show your users actually use.
Now test load speed. Use Google PageSpeed Insights or a similar tool to check how fast your form page loads on mobile networks. If it takes more than 2-3 seconds, you're losing conversions before users even see your form. Optimize images, minimize scripts, and consider lazy-loading non-essential elements.
Pay attention to the mobile keyboard behavior. When a user taps into an email field, the email keyboard with the @ symbol should appear. Phone fields should bring up the numeric keypad. If users have to manually switch keyboards to enter information, you've created unnecessary friction.
Verify that your form doesn't require zooming to read or complete. If users have to pinch and zoom to see field labels or tap buttons accurately, your form isn't mobile-optimized—it's just a desktop form shrunk down. Everything should be comfortably readable and tappable at the default zoom level. A mobile-optimized form builder handles these responsive design challenges automatically.
Your success indicator: you can complete your form on a mobile device in under 60 seconds without any frustration, confusion, or need to zoom. The form loads quickly, fields are easy to tap, the appropriate keyboards appear automatically, and the submit button is easily accessible. If you find yourself thinking "this is annoying" at any point, fix it before launching.
Step 7: Set Up A/B Testing and Continuous Optimization
You've built an optimized form based on best practices. Great start. But optimization isn't a destination—it's an ongoing process. What works today might not work as your audience evolves, your market shifts, or your business priorities change.
Create a testing roadmap that prioritizes high-impact elements. Start with the biggest variables: form length, submit button copy, and overall layout. These typically have the largest effect on conversion rates. Save minor tweaks like button color or label wording for later—they matter, but they're not where you'll find dramatic improvements.
Set up your first A/B test focusing on a single variable. Maybe you test a 3-field form against your current 5-field form. Maybe you test "Get Started" versus "Request Information" as button copy. Test one thing at a time so you can clearly attribute any change in conversion rate to that specific element. The goal is to consistently improve contact form conversion rates through data-driven decisions.
Determine your sample size requirements before you start. How many form submissions do you need to reach statistical significance? If you only get 50 form submissions per month, you'll need to run tests for several months to get reliable results. Be patient—making changes based on insufficient data is worse than not testing at all.
Document everything. When you launch a test, note the date, what you're testing, your hypothesis, and your success criteria. When the test concludes, document the results and your decision. This creates institutional knowledge and prevents you from re-testing things you've already learned.
Implement winning variations systematically. When a test shows clear improvement, roll out the winner to 100% of traffic. Then start your next test. Avoid the temptation to run multiple overlapping tests unless you have massive traffic—it muddies your data and makes it impossible to know what actually drove results.
Build a culture of continuous testing. Set a goal to always have at least one active test running. Even small, incremental improvements compound over time. A 5% improvement here, a 3% improvement there—within a year, you've potentially doubled your form conversion rate through systematic optimization.
Your success indicator: you have at least one active test running, a documented testing roadmap for the next three to six months, and a clear process for implementing winning variations. If you've optimized your form once and called it done, you're missing ongoing opportunities for improvement. Optimization is a mindset, not a project.
Putting It All Together
Optimizing your contact form design isn't a one-time project—it's an ongoing commitment to reducing friction between interested visitors and your sales team. By following these seven steps, you've built a foundation for forms that respect your visitors' time while delivering the qualified leads your business needs.
Quick checklist before you launch: baseline metrics documented, fields reduced to essentials, conditional logic implemented where appropriate, visual design polished for clarity, microcopy refined to guide and reassure, mobile experience verified across devices, and testing framework ready for continuous improvement.
Start with the steps that address your biggest current pain points. If analytics show massive abandonment at field three, focus there first. If mobile conversion rates lag desktop significantly, prioritize mobile optimization. You don't need to implement everything at once—systematic improvement beats trying to do everything simultaneously.
Remember that every small improvement compounds over time. A form that converts 2% better might not feel significant this month, but over a year that's hundreds of additional leads. Over several years with continuous optimization, you've transformed your contact form from a conversion barrier into a competitive advantage.
The best contact forms feel effortless. Users don't think about them—they just complete them and move forward. That's your goal: invisible friction, clear value, and a seamless path from interested visitor to qualified lead.
Transform your lead generation with AI-powered forms that qualify prospects automatically while delivering the modern, conversion-optimized experience your high-growth team needs. Start building free forms today and see how intelligent form design can elevate your conversion strategy.
